Skate - EA Games (Xbox 360)
Possibly my best purchase this first half of the year! I love free skating and the character customization is a little lacking in the clothing department, but its still amazing. This game I thought was going to be like Tony Hawk, with a different story, boy was I ever wrong! It is nothing like Tony Hawk! (Except some of the pros) The control scheme takes a little getting used to, but its way better than Tony Hawk's once you get used to them. You will fail a lot in this game, which is great because there is an achievement for breaking all of the bones in your body at least 10 times each.

Rock Band - MTV Games, Activision, Electronic Arts (Xbox 360)
I was prepped for this game the moment I heard of it! Coming from the previous makers of Guitar Hero, I knew this game would not let me down! With some new kickass peripherals, its way more fun than Guitar Hero. And a great party game to boot! The price tag is the only thing that let me down. $160 for a video game and even more money for downloadable content, luckily, everything is of great quality!
